18) A light ray gets reflected from the x=-2. If the reflected ray touches the circle `x^2 + y^2 = 4` and point of incident is (-2,-4), then equation of incident ray is A)4y + 3x + 22 = 0 B) 3y + 4x + 20 = 0 C) 4y + 2x + 20 = 0 D) y+x+6-0

A

`4y+3x+22=0`

B

`3y+4x+20=0`

C

`4y+2x+20=0`

D

`y+x+6=0`

The correct Answer is:
1


Any tangent of `x^(2)+y^(2)=4` is `y= mx +- 2 sqrt(1+mk^(2))`. If it passes through `(- 2, -4)`, then
or `4m^(2)-4)^(2)=4(1+m^(2))`
or `4m^(2)+16-16m= 4+4m^(2)`
or `m = oo, m= (3)/(4)`
Hence, the slope of the reflected ray is `3//4`
Thus, the equation of the incident rays is
`(y+4)= -(3)/(4) (x+2) ` i.e., `4y+3x+22=0`
